What Services Do Napa Plumbing Companies Offer?
Leak Repair
Leaking pipes that aren't addressed promptly can increase your water bills and damage the nearby area. A plumbing specialist can locate the exact point of the leak and repair it directly at that spot.
Clog Repair
Congested drains and pipes may lead to flooding, backflow, and damage. Area plumbers can remove obstructions and give advice for averting them later on.
Pipe Replacement
Pipes become damaged over time. If they're leaking or warping, they may need to be replaced. A plumbing expert in Napa can assess your pipes' health and swap out worn and broken components with new, durable materials.
Fixture Installation
Some fixtures wear down with age and require installing something new. Other times, you may replace them as part of a renovation. A plumber can install something as simple as a new faucet or as complex as a new shower, sink, bathtub, or toilet.
Gas Repair
In addition to typical plumbing work, some plumbers train to find and fix gas leaks from appliances such as radiators and ovens. Should you notice the familiar scent of a gas leak, leave the house and call your utility provider.
Annual Inspections
Your plumbing undergoes a lot of daily wear and tear, so it's important to schedule regular inspections. Getting a yearly check can help detect problems before they turn severe, saving you money on repairs in the long run.
Emergency Services
Plumbers provide urgent services to handle burst pipes, backfilling toilets, and other immediate issues. While emergency repair bills tend to be more expensive than planned ones, immediate action is often essential to prevent further home damage.
Cost of Plumbing Services in Napa
Napa plumbers typically charge between $130 and $433 for installation and repair work. Emergency jobs will almost always incur additional charges. Use the table below for specific cost data on common plumbing services in Napa.
| Project | Estimated Cost |
|---|---|
| Clog and drain clearing | $88 - $441 |
| Leak repair | $132 - $397 |
| Burst pipe repair | $907 - $3,630 |
| Faucet installation | $141 - $565 |
| Toilet installation | $295 - $788 |
| Pipe rerouting | $659 - $1,412 |
| Main water line repair | $460 - $3,677 |
| Water heater repair | $136 - $681 |
| Water heater installation | $788 - $1,970 |
| Water softener installation | $202 - $504 |
Check Licensing and Insurance
The California Contractors State License Board issues state C-36 licenses to Napa plumbers. Business owners must meet all experience and exam requirements. Also, make sure your plumber is properly insured and bonded in case of any damage or accidents during the job.
Check Union Status
Plumbers who are part of national or state trade unions typically charge more for labor. However, many Napa homeowners prefer them because the union requires strong vetting and training standards.
Assess Their Experience
Seek out a plumbing company that has several years of experience working with Napa homeowners. They'll be more familiar with the local landscape and could solve your problem faster and more effectively.
Read Customer Reviews
Visit sites like Google Reviews and the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to read customer reviews on local plumbers. You can find out more about how companies handle complaints, the quality of their work, and the strength of their customer service.
Compare Multiple Quotes
Request free estimates from multiple plumbing contractors to get an idea of local market rates. Avoid companies that offer unusually low or high rates.
Ask About Warranties and Guarantees
Many plumbers offer service warranties to protect you in case an issue returns within a given timeframe. You should also ask about warranties on any new appliances, such as toilets and sinks, that you're getting professionally installed.
